C Jean Horst Quilts
While there are many fine quilt designers in Lancaster, C Jean Horst’s quilt creations stand out from all the others. Her ability to select fabrics and create custom quilts is phenomenal.
Jean tells how her mother taught her, at the age of five, to use her sewing machine to make doll clothes. She has been sewing ever since. Yet it was on a family vacation much later that she first discovered the creative and colorful world of quilts. In spite of living in Lancaster County, Pennsylvania, the quilt capitol of the world, she purchased her first pattern while on vacation in Tennessee.
Her hobby has now become a meaningful business of 36 years. She works with many ambitious women, who piece, appliqué, mark, quilt, and bind quilts and crib quilts, creating heirlooms for tomorrow and functional art for today. She has had the privilege of designing and managing some very special projects. Of special note she designed the Governor’s Star – an original quilt for Governor Tom Ridge, and a millennium quilt “It’s About Time” for an American Cancer Society raffle (which raised over $30,000!) as well as doing quilts for a Disney Movie “Utterly Beloved.”

The Lone Star quilt is likely one of the most recognizable quilt patterns to Americans. It is also one of the oldest patterns. The Amish love the large central star pattern and make their fair share of them. Its a beautiful but difficult design to get all the corners meeting at the points of the diamonds. This is a beautiful example of precision piecing with the use of 12 quilters fabrics for the star. The backing of the quilt is done with a cream solid color fabric and the hand quilting stitches are counted at 8 per inch. A Beauty of a quilt with the extra quilting designs that show up so lovely on the bed top as well as the side drop.

What is a Stack and Whack?? It's so fun to do....Here is a quilt making style that uses one fabric and layers the same exact repeat on top of each other 8 times. The triangles are cut through a floral fabric to make 8 exact pieces which are sewn together for one patch. As you cut across the fabric for more patches you will be getting many different areas of a large print fabric which turns out to be a surprise every time! Here this design has a fun zebra print on the binding as well as added to the corners of the patches at various places. The hand quilting is done well and is 7 stitches per inch.
